Galaxy of Fear

Tash and Zak are survivors of the destruction of Alderaan, two Force-sensitive children who are trying to hide from the Galactic Empire while investigating the lost histories of the Jedi.

The protagonists discover pieces of a large Imperial experiment in biological weapons, codenamed Project Starscream.

The first six books deal with the heroes discovering the various components of Project Starscream, each dangerous in its own right.
